Abstract: In this thesis, we utilize the hydrodynamical model to evaluate the potential energy and self-energy for an electron and a hydrogen atom placed between two semi-infinite metal slabs. The potentials and self-energies are obtained by taking into account of the dispersion of the surface plasmons and the effect of confinement by the metal slabs.
